win10系统下安装64位Oracle11g+LSQL Developer
LSQL Developer作为强大的Oracle编辑工具,却只支持32bit,本文提供在安装用LSQL Developer打开64bitOracle的操作方法
工具/原料
方法/步骤
在Oracle官网下载安装包,下载后,得到的文件如图所示:
将两个文件进行解压缩,得到目录如图所示:
双击setup.exe,系统将会进行自检,若提示[INS-13001]环境不满足最低要求,如图所示:
点击"否"终止安装,然后打开解压缩目录中\stage\cvu\cvu_prereq.xml,把下列文字添加到图片位置:
<OPERATING_SYSTEM RELEASE="6.2">
<VERSION VALUE="3"/>
<ARCHITECTURE VALUE="32-bit"/>
<NAME VALUE="Windows 10"/>
<ENV_VAR_LIST>
<ENV_VAR NAME="PATH" MAX_LENGTH="1023" />
</ENV_VAR_LIST>
</OPERATING_SYSTEM>
<OPERATING_SYSTEM RELEASE="6.2">
<VERSION VALUE="3"/>
<ARCHITECTURE VALUE="64-bit"/>
<NAME VALUE="Windows 10"/>
<ENV_VAR_LIST>
<ENV_VAR NAME="PATH" MAX_LENGTH="1023" />
</ENV_VAR_LIST>
</OPERATING_SYSTEM>
再次双击setup.exe,出现下图所示安装界面,"取消通过My Oracle Support接收安全更新",点击下一步。
提示出现尚未提供电子邮件地址,选择是。
选择创建和配置数据库(默认),点击下一步。
选择桌面类(默认),点击下一步。
选择安装目录,输入管理口令,点击下一步。
若出现口令不符合建议标准,不影响继续安装,选择是。
点击完成,安装数据库。
先决条件检查,若全部成功,点击下一步;若检查失败,勾选全部忽略,点击下一步。
进入数据库配置辅助页面,点击口令管理。
默认sys和system用户可用,可以将scott用户启动,设置口令,点击确定。
点击确定,提示Oracle Database的安装已成功,点击关闭。
1、Oracle服务
我的电脑->管理->服务->Oracle
查看Oracle服务的安装情况
其中服务名为:OracleRemExecService是安装过程启动的临时服务,在完成Oracle的安装后,重新启动计算机,该服务会自动停止并注销。
2、网页检查Oracle的运行情况
打开网页,输入地址:
https://localhost:1158/em
可以看到Oracle的运行报表
当出现不安全连接的提示时,请选择高级->继续前往并输入用户和密码
3、环境变量
相关的环境变量已经设置了,PATH路径也增加了
4、命令行登录测试
进入cmd输入:sqlplus sys/password@orcl as sysdba
验证已经可以登录
三、安装PLSQL Developer
安装PLSQL Developer,跟常规软件安装过程相同,如下:
下载oracle11g的32位客户端并将其解压缩到oracle安装目录的product目录下(如:C:\Application\Develop\Database\Oracle\product)。
将Oracle安装目录中的tnsnames.ora(位于%Oracle_Home%\NETWORK\ADMIN中)的tnsnames.ora文件拷贝至instantclient_11_2目录下。
进入PL/SQL,不登录进入,选择Tools --> Preferences,设置Oracle Home和OCI library。
如:
Oracle Home:
C:\Application\Develop\Database\Oracle\product\instantclient_11_2
OCI library:
C:\Application\Develop\Database\Oracle\product\instantclient_11_2\oci.dll
设置PLSQL启动方式(两种方式)
1)在PLSQL Developer安装目录下,创建脚本文件,内容如下:
@echo off
set path=C:\Application\Develop\Database\Oracle\product\instantclient_11_2
set ORACLE_HOME=C:\Application\Develop\Database\Oracle\product\instantclient_11_2
set TNS_ADMIN=C:\Application\Develop\Database\Oracle\product\instantclient_11_2
set NLS_LANG=AMERICAN_AMERICA.ZHS16GBK
start plsqldev.exe
温馨提示:用该bat文件代替PL/SQL快捷方式,启动PLSQL Developer。
2)添加系统环境变量
①变量名:NSL_LANG,变量值:AMERICAN_AMERICA.ZHS16GBK
②变量名:TNS_ADMIN,
变量值:C:\Application\Develop\Database\Oracle\product\instantclient_11_2
温馨提示:根据自己的安装目录来设置。
win10系统下安装64位Oracle11g+LSQL Developer的更多相关文章
- 无光驱在32位windows系统下安装64位windows系统
位的系统. 大家都知道,32位的操作系统最多只能支持3.2G的内存,现在内存白菜价,很多人都在原有基础上购入新内存,这样最少也有4G了,为了让内存不浪费,我 们只有升级到64位操作系统.但是很多朋友又 ...
- 32位的Win7系统下安装64位的Sql Sever?
来自:http://zhidao.baidu.com/link?url=nQBoaLgoOyYCUdI7V4WZCMlTW3tKscdkOnLTIvlYtPpwoVhQkSahq44HeofBfzFT ...
- Ubuntu 16下安装64位谷歌Chrome浏览器
Ubuntu 16下安装64位谷歌Chrome浏览器 1.将下载源加入到系统的源列表 在终端中,输入以下命令: sudo wget https://repo.fdzh.org/chrome/googl ...
- Win10系统下安装ubuntu16.04双系统-常见问题解答
Win10系统下安装ubuntu16.04双系统-常见问题解答 1. 安装ubuntu16.04.2系统 磁盘分区形式有两种:GPT和MBR,关系到设置引导项.在win10下压缩出500GB空间给ub ...
- Xmind pro Win10系统下安装问题解决与破解
Xmind pro Win10系统下安装问题解决与破解 1.下载安装版本 解压包含文件: xmind-8-update7-windows--安装包 和XMindCrack.jar--激活破解工具 2. ...
- 在64位Windows7上安装64位Oracle11g
我一直在用Oracle10g数据库,最近想看看11g怎么样,就试着装了一下,在安装过程中遇到的麻烦还不少,幸好有搜索引擎,根据前辈的指点,磕磕绊绊地也将Oracle装上了,作一下记录,以后也许能用得着 ...
- Win10系统下安装编辑器之神(The God of Editor)Vim并且构建Python生态开发环境(2020年最新攻略)
原文转载自「刘悦的技术博客」https://v3u.cn/a_id_160 众神殿内,依次坐着Editplus.Atom.Sublime.Vscode.JetBrains家族.Comodo等等一众编辑 ...
- Windows 7/8 64位下安装64位Apache 2.4.7
准备软件: VC11 运行库 64位的apache版本 传送门:http://www.apachelounge.com/download/ 安装步骤: 修改httpd.conf配置文件 37行: Se ...
- Win10系统下安装Ubuntu16.04.3教程与设置
在Win10上刚刚装好Ubuntu16.04.3,装了不下于10次,期间出现很多问题,趁着还有记忆,写下这篇教程,里面还有Ubuntu系统的优化与Win10的一些设置. Part 1 制作Ubuntu ...
随机推荐
- python学习(六)元组学习
元组就是列表的一种,不过元组具有不可变性,而且是用圆括号访问的. 索引(下表索引或者键索引都是用的中括号) #!/usr/bin/python # 这节来学习元组, tuple, 基本上就像一个不可以 ...
- Ubuntu 14.04lts安装vncserver
之前有在centos上安装过非常多次vncserver,也写过一个centos 7上的安装文档.近来常识了好几次在ubuntu上安装都没有成功,这次最终搞定了.ubuntu自带的桌面是unity.这个 ...
- 未加载Microsoft.SqlServer.management.sdk.sfc version......
这个问题卡了我好久,于是决定记录下来,我这里缺失的是Microsoft.SqlServer.management.sdk.sfc version 12.0.0,当然你也可能后面是11开头的, 这个是由 ...
- 关于proplists:get_value/2 与lists:keyfind/3 的效率比较
关于proplists:get_value/2 与lists:keyfind/2 的效率 早有比较,已出结论,lists:keyfind/2 的效率要好很多,好些人都是直接用或者做过它们之间的比较测试 ...
- 循序渐进学Python 1 安装与入门
1 安装 2 使用 2.1 运行程序 3 艺搜参考 by 2013年10月16日 安装 Windows安装版,源码,帮助文档: 使用 打开开始菜单中的Python GUI启动Python解释器: 启动 ...
- t60替换alt,super,ctrl
发现T60的左边在ctrl 与 alt 有个win 键,所以就进行了映射 网上有一个把alt->ctrl, super-> alt, ctrl->super的script, 见 ht ...
- [转]C#中的结构体与类的区别
C#中的结构体与类的区别 经常听到有朋友在讨论C#中的结构与类有什么区别.正好这几日闲来无事,自己总结一下,希望大家指点. 1. 首先是语法定义上的区别啦,这个就不用多说了.定义类使用关键字cla ...
- c++动态绑定的技术实现
1 什么是动态绑定 有一个基类,两个派生类,基类有一个virtual函数,两个派生类都覆盖了这个虚函数.现在有一个基类的指针或者引用,当该基类指针或者引用指向不同的派生类对象时,调用该虚函数,那么最终 ...
- js添加方法和邦定事件
function(obj,objArr){ if(($(obj).attr("type") == "checkbox" && $j(obj).p ...
- log4j 2 入门实例(2)
本文介绍将日志输出到文件的例子. log4j 2输出到文件 log4j2.xml文件 这个文件里,定义了三个类型的Appender:Console.File和RollingFile. Console类 ...